Blair has always known exactly who she is.

Standing on her patch of Watson since 1964, she's watched Menzies give way to mini skirts, mini skirts give way to renovations three doors down, and still she hasn't felt the need to change a thing. Some homes chase trends. Blair simply waits for the trends to come back around to her.

Step through the front door and the original bones are all still here, honest, solid, unbothered brick-and-timber construction from an era that built things to last. The kitchen's mid life facelift makes her functional, and she'll be the first to admit it, this is where your imagination gets to do the talking. Good layout, good light, and a blank canvas for whoever's ready to bring her up to date.

Then there's the bathroom. Powder pink and baby blue tiles, original, immaculate, and unapologetically retro, the kind of tiles you simply cannot buy anymore. Some buyers will want to update her. Others will walk in, gasp, and beg you never to touch a single tile. Either way, she's magnificent.

East-facing rooms mean Blair wakes up glowing, morning light pouring through sleek custom fit roman blinds (privacy blinds at the front, for the sticky-beaks) before settling into soft, easy afternoons. Timber floors run warm underfoot throughout, while ducted heating and evaporative cooling keep her comfortable no matter the season, Canberra can throw what it likes at her.

Out back, a spotted gum deck, oiled and cared for, sits half-shaded beneath a pergola. It's the kind of spot made for long lunches and longer evenings, a glass of something cold, and absolutely nowhere else to be.

And then there's the block. Large, flat, and full of possibility, this is the kind of space that makes you start mentally placing the veggie patch, the cubby house, the trampoline, before you've even finished the walk-through. A standalone double garage rounds out the practicality of it all.

Blair isn't pretending to be a display home. She's better than that, she's the real thing, original, honest, and quietly waiting for someone who can see exactly what she could become.

FINE DETAILS (all approximate):

Land size: 726 m2
Living size: 138m2 (approx.)
EER: 3.5

Build year: 1964

Rates: $1,246 pq (approx)
Land Tax (is tenanted): $2,574 (approx)
UV: $832,000 (2026)
